Vous êtes sur la page 1sur 2

ÉVOLUTION DE LA PROGRAMATION DE 1837 A NOS JOUR

L’évolution des langages de programmation informatique


À l’ère du numérique, où presque tout est instantanément possible en quelques clics, il est
facile d’oublier le chemin parcouru au cours de cette incroyable avancée technologique.
Jetons un coup d’œil à certaines étapes clés de l’évolution des langages de programmation
informatique :

1843 – Ada Lovelace programme pour le moteur analytique de Charles Babbage


Considéré comme le « père de l’ordinateur », Charles Babbage proposa en 1837 la machine
analytique, un ordinateur mécanique polyvalent. En 1843, Ada Lovelace, la première femme
programmeuse informatique au monde, a été la première à réaliser qu’un moteur analytique
pouvait faire plus que de simples calculs et a publié les premiers algorithmes conçus pour
fonctionner dessus.

1949 – L’assemblage devient le premier type de langage de programmation largement utilisé


Comme mentionné ci-dessus, ce type de langage de programmation de bas niveau est
important car il a été le premier à permettre aux programmeurs d’écrire du code en utilisant
des symboles au lieu du code binaire. Aujourd’hui encore, le même type de programmation
informatique est utilisé dans des logiciels en temps réel comme les systèmes de navigation
de vol de simulation et les équipements de surveillance médicale, ou pour créer des virus
informatiques.
1952 – Autocode devient le premier langage de programmation informatique compilé
Développé à l’origine par Alick Glennie pour l’ordinateur Mark 1, l’autocode est un terme utilisé
pour désigner une famille de « systèmes de codage simplifiés ». Les langages de
programmation ultérieurs ont été renommés, y compris des exemples tels que Cobol et
Fortran.

Bien que Fortran ne soit pas largement utilisé dans l’industrie aujourd’hui, il est toujours
utilisé par la NASA et est toujours populaire en science et en ingénierie.
1957 – Fortran est conçu pour le calcul numérique et le calcul scientifique
Développé par John Backus et IBM, Fortran est considéré comme le premier langage de haut
niveau, conçu pour être relativement facile à apprendre et largement applicable.

Plus important encore, Fortran a permis aux programmeurs de développer des logiciels 500 %
plus rapidement qu’en écrivant du code en langage assembleur ou en langage machine.

Le logiciel qui a fait fonctionner les vaisseaux spatiaux Voyager 1 et 2 de la NASA a été écrit
en Fortran 5.

1959 – Le Cobol s’impose comme langage commun orienté métier


Il est devenu le langage de choix pour les applications professionnelles et doit une grande
partie de sa popularité à IBM.
1964 – BASIC (Beginners’ All-Purpose Symbolic Instruction Code)
Conçu par John G. Kennedy et Thomas E. Kurtz, le langage de programmation BASIC se
voulait aussi accessible que possible, et il n’est pas surprenant qu’il ait fini par dominer le
marché des ordinateurs domestiques qui a émergé dans les années 1970. En 1991, Microsoft
avait développé Visual Basic en combinant une version actualisée de BASIC avec un
constructeur visuel de formulaires.

1972 – Le langage C commence à façonner l’avenir de l’ordinateur personnel.


C’est la mère de presque toutes les langues de haut niveau et reste aujourd’hui l’une des
langues les plus populaires au monde. Il peut être utilisé dans les systèmes d’exploitation
informatiques, les implémentations de systèmes embarqués et les environnements Web
utilisant l’interface de passerelle commune (CGI).

Les langages de programmation dérivés du C comprennent C#, D, Go, Java, JavaScript, Limbo,
Python et d’autres.
En 1997, 80 % des entreprises dans le monde utilisaient Cobol. En 2020, l’Internal Revenue
Service des États-Unis est passé à un IMF (Individual Master File) basé sur Cobol pour aider
les citoyens et les entreprises dans le cadre de programmes de secours et de lutte contre la
pandémie de coronavirus.

Vous aimerez peut-être aussi